The Dodgers acquired left-handed reliever Scott Alexander from the Royals in a three-way trade that also involved the White Sox. The Dodgers sent Trevor Oaks to Kansas City and Luis Avilan to Chicago and received minor league infielder Jake Peter from Chicago as well. Relief pitcher Joakim Soria went from Kansas City to Chicago in the trade.

Alexander gives the Dodgers bullpen a different look
Scott Alexander throws his sinker more often than just about any other pitcher in baseball, and his inducing ground balls gives the Dodgers bullpen a new dimension they haven’t had in recent years.
